A person who knowingly makes a false report of the theft or conversion of a vehicle to a police officer or to the commissioner shall be fined not more than five hundred dollars or imprisoned not more than six months or both.
Conn. Gen. Stat. § 14-198
False report
Known as the Uniform Motor Vehicle Certificate of Title and Antitheft Act
